# --- Crashpipe settings -------------------------------------
# Heads up: this config drives the Fernbok mobile crash-report
# pipeline. Incoming reports get deduped by stack fingerprint
# before landing in storage, so don't panic if raw counts look
# lower than the dashboard. Batch size and retry knobs are
# further down — defaults are fine for local work. The pipeline
# writes processed reports to the store referenced just below.

replica DSN, kajep-yahag: mssql://praok_svc:iF@db-8d68.plorvaio.local:5432/eliion

## Runbook: Releasing Vaultspin

Vaultspin (our in-house secrets-rotation tool) ships whenever the rotation schema changes, so don't sit on merged PRs. Bump the version, run the smoke suite against the Harlow sandbox, and tag. The deploy job won't pick up the tag until the artifact is signed — yes, even for patch releases. Sign the tagged build using the key that follows.

signing key of bagap-yawep = bky13_TbfT6ZMUoGJo2

# Break-Glass: Catalog Cache Invalidation

Scope: the Pinrow product catalog at Veldstone Retail. If stale prices persist after a purge and the Hollowmere invalidation queue is wedged, use break-glass to flush the edge tier directly. Contractors: get verbal sign-off from the catalog lead first. Steps: open the Hollowmere admin shell, select emergency-flush, confirm the tenant, and run it once — repeated flushes thrash the origin. Access is logged and expires after 20 minutes. Unseal the admin shell with the passphrase below.

recovery phrase for kahop-tajog: istix-casvan

Finance Review Summary — For the Incoming Director, Tavenor Goods

The pilot with the Bramwick retail chain closed the quarter slightly ahead of plan: sell-through of 74% against a 70% target, with returns under 2%. Margins held despite promotional pricing in two districts. Bramwick has signaled interest in expansion. Planned next steps are set out confidentially below.

board note of baguf-fafog: Kasixox Foods plans to lower the Drueth list price by 48 percent in March.